Seabuckthorn

Frozen seabuckthorn is fresh seabuckthorn that has been washed, sorted, and then frozen. Seabuckthorn is a small fruit that is high in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als, particularly vitamin C.

Frozen seabuckthorn can be used in a variety of recipes, such as smoothies, desserts, jams, and sauces. It can also be used as a decorative element in plating. When cooking with frozen seabuckthorn, you should thaw it first and then use it as you would any other fruit.

It's important to note that frozen seabuckthorn may have a softer texture than fresh seabuckthorn, but it will still provide flavor and nutrients to your dish. When buying frozen seabuckthorn, look for packages that do not contain any additives or preservatives. You should also check that the fruit is not clumped together, as this can indicate that they have been thawed and refrozen.
